Constellation Brands (STZ) shares reached an all time high after an excellent fourth quarter and raised guidance for 2017. Revenue came in at $1.54 billion, a 14.1% increase year-over-year. Constellation finished the year with $1.4 billion in operating cash flow an increase of 31%.

Constellation has been on a roll recently with acquisitions, after completing its purchase of Meiomi Pinot Noir, one of the best performing wines in the $20 price point range. The company is hoping to continue this success after announcing today the purchase of the Prisoner Wine Company to enhance its fine wine portfolio.

One of the biggest news stories in the beer world in 2015 was when Constellation entered the craft beer industry in 2015 by adding Ballast Point Brewing Companyfor $1 billion, a record-breaking acquisition. Ballast Point added $27 million in revenue for Constellation since the acquisition was completed in Mid December 2015. Ballast Point continues to be one of the fastest-growing major craft beer companies in the country.

Ballast Point has experienced a depletion growth rate of 130% in 2016 and sold four million cases — three times that of any major competitor. By comparison, Constellation Brands flagship brand Corona Extra sold 117 Million cases in 2016 and is now the fifth biggest beer brand in the U.S. and the No. 1 imported beer.
